3. Cloud-Native Applications Dominate Enterprise IT

Cloud technology continues to transform how applications are developed and managed.

Businesses are increasingly adopting cloud-native architectures built on:

  • Microservices
  • Containers
  • Kubernetes
  • Serverless computing
  • Multi-cloud environments

Cloud-native development enables organizations to scale rapidly while maintaining reliability and performance.

Benefits of Cloud-Native Development

  • Faster deployment cycles
  • Reduced infrastructure costs
  • Improved application performance
  • Enhanced business continuity
  • Better disaster recovery capabilities

Cloud-first strategies are expected to become the standard across industries throughout 2026.

5. Cybersecurity-First Development Approaches

As cyber threats continue to evolve, security is becoming a foundational element of software development.

Development teams are implementing:

  • Secure-by-design architectures
  • Zero Trust security models
  • Multi-factor authentication
  • Continuous vulnerability monitoring
  • Advanced threat detection systems

Organizations can no longer treat cybersecurity as an afterthought. Security must be integrated into every stage of the software development lifecycle.

9. API-First Development Strategies

Businesses today rely on multiple software platforms that must work together seamlessly.

API-first development enables:

  • Better system integration
  • Faster development
  • Improved scalability
  • Enhanced user experiences

From payment gateways to CRM systems and AI services, APIs have become the backbone of modern software ecosystems.
